Mannix Court, Mooragh Promenade, Ramsey, Isle Of Man, IM8 3ba
The proposal involves removing poor condition timber framed sliding sash windows and some existing uPVC casements from the front and rear elevations of Mannix Court, a five-storey terraced property in a mixed-use area of Ramsey, and replacing them with white uPVC framed, double glazed, top hung casement windows matchin…

The officer assessed the proposal against the character of the Mooragh Promenade terraces in a mixed-use area under the Ramsey Local Plan, noting the site is not within a Conservation Area.
Time limit
The development hereby permitted shall commence before the expiration of four years from the date of this notice.
Approved drawings
This approval relates to the submitted documents and drawings 07 0192/1, 07 0192/2, 07 0192/3, 07 0192/4, 07 0192/5 and 07 0192/6 all received on 19th March 2007.

SPMCE objects to top-hung casement windows and insists on sliding sashes; Fire and Rescue requires consultation on rear windows; Highways and Ramsey Town Commissioners have no objection.
Key concern: top-hung sashes inappropriate for historic promenade terraces
Society for the Preservation of the Manx Countryside & Environment
Objection"Seems OK but window replacement MUST be sliding sashes (of whatever material)."; "we OBJECT to top-hung sashes in such locations"
Conditions requested: window replacement MUST be sliding sashes (of whatever material); firm stand should be taken NOW to ensure that all replacements are vertical sliding sashes (of whatever material)
Isle of Man Fire and Rescue Service
Conditional No ObjectionTHIS PROPERTY FALLS WITHIN THE REMIT OF THE FIRE PRECAUTIONS (FLATS) REGULATIONS 1996.
Conditions requested: THE APPLICANT IS REQUIRED TO CONSULT THE FLATS INSPECTION TEAM AT THE FIRE SAFETY DEPARTMENT WITH REGARD TO THE WINDOWS TO THE REAR OF THE PREMISES, ADJACENT TO THE EXTERNAL FIRE ESCAPE
Highways Division of the Department of Transport
No ObjectionThe Highways Division of the Department of Transport has no views on this application. The application having been considered, the response is: Do not oppose
Ramsey Town Commissioners
No Objectionthe Ramsey Town Commissioners considered the above application at their meeting on Wednesday 18th April, 2007 and have no objection to the proposal.
